    Description

      1. EXEC: launch the OpenShift application wizard
      2. EXEC: in the embedded cartridges, check jenkins-client
      3. ASSERT: you get a dialog that tells you that you have to create a jenkins application
      4. EXEC: hit "Apply"
      5. ASSERT: you get prompted to provide a name for the jenkins application
      6. EXEC: provide some name
      7. ASSERT: wait until you get the creation log presented in a dialog

      Result:
      The dialogs shows null

      Expected:
      The creation log dialog prints the IP, username and password for your jenkins instance

      Workaround:

      • embed jenkins-client afterwards by picking Edit Embeddable Cartridges in the context menu of your application in the OpenShift Explorer
        =OR=
      • look the credentials up in the environment variables by picking Environament Variables in the context menu of your application in OpenShift Explorer
